SUMMARY

On behalf of CNS Cares, LLC (“CNS” or “Company”), this position is responsible for scheduling our field staff for patient visits, as well as overseeing the delivery of coordinated care for a patient and/or an assigned group of patients. Additionally, this position is responsible for maximizing authorization units, advocating for the needs of each patient, communication with all entities to provide quick and accurate service, and ensure patient satisfaction with impeccable service.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ES. Employee must have regular attendance/punctuality, be able to work with others at all levels of the Company, have exceptional customer service, and be completely honest. Other assigned duties include:

1.Demonstrate excellent communication skills. Communicates regularly with patients, nurses, home health aides, and claims team. Communicates with the General Manager and Director of Nursing on patient status and care being provided in home.

2. Schedule visits for the care team within the electronic medical record (EMR). Works to find coverage in situations where there is staffing needs. Works with the recruiting team and local leadership to adequately source and hire new staff. Expectation to utilize 100% of authorized hours. Ensures clinical compliance items are scheduled and completed per company and state guidelines.

3. Identify patient needs for durable medical equipment and coordinate with DME companies to ensure patients’ needs are met.

4. Evaluate patient conditions not currently covered by the Department of Labor and coordinate and assist patients to get consequential illnesses added to their DOL covered conditions.

5. Assist authorization team with start of cares and renewal periods to advocate and justify the appropriate care level for each patient.

6. Attend medical appointments with patient to assist as a resource to physicians regarding the Department of Labor Home Health Care program.

7.Gather medical records as needed.

8. Ensure all authorized units are staffed by the assigned skilled nurse or home health aide with expectation to limit overtime. Coordinate with GM and DON for appropriate direction.

9. Provide EMR and home orientation training to staff.

10. Participate in an on-call rotation.

11. Adhere to all company policies.

12. Other duties as assigned
